Condizione: VG. 15pp extract, printed in double columns, illustrated with 14 characteristic Scribner's engravings, salvaged from a damaged issue of Scribner's Magazine, Volume XX, No. 6, October, 1880. The poor area of New York City bounded by 65th and 85th streets, and by Central Park and 8th Avenue. Illustrations i…nclude the corner of 68th Street and 11th Avenue, a character, a scene in the German quarter, Shantytown Geese, the corner of 82nd Street and 9th Avenue, sketching under difficulties, the water-works, a timid observer, the leading business, a trucker shanty, some bird shanties, and others of general interest. Condizione: Good. 5pp extract, printed in double columns, illustrated with three drawings by the author, including 2 full-page plates, one of the back of the other, salvaged from a damaged issue of The Century Illustrated Monthly Magazine, Volume XLVII, No. 1, November, 1893. First-hand account of a short battle betw…een the Army and two renegade Cheyenne Indians who had been accused of murdering a boy. The battle left the two Indians dead. Artists' Adventures Series.
